What is the TELC B1 Assessment?TELC, or "The European Language Certificates," offers a standardized structure for examining language proficiency across different languages, consisting of German. The B1 level shows a lower-intermediate efficiency in the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). Candidates at this level ought to be able to:
- Understand the bottom lines of clear basic speech on familiar matters.
- Handle most circumstances most likely to develop when taking a trip in a German-speaking country.
- Produce easy linked text on topics that are familiar or of individual interest.
- Describe experiences, occasions, dreams, hopes, and ambitions.
The TELC B1 assessment includes 4 sections:
SectionDescriptionDurationListeningCandidates listen to audio recordings and address concerns based upon them.Thirty minutesChecking outIndividuals read different texts and react to comprehension concerns.30 minutesWritingCandidates write a brief text (e.g., a letter or an e-mail) based upon offered prompts.Thirty minutesSpeakingAn in person interview where candidates talk about topics with an inspector.15 minutesOnline Format
